As businesses embrace cloud computing, they must decide how to structure their infrastructure. Two of the most common approaches—hybrid cloud and multi-cloud—offer unique advantages, but they serve different purposes. While hybrid cloud combines private and public cloud environments, multi-cloud distributes workloads across multiple cloud providers. Understanding their differences is essential for making informed decisions about security, cost management, and scalability.
The Foundation: Public vs. Private Cloud
Before comparing hybrid and multi-cloud, it’s important to understand their underlying components.
A public cloud refers to cloud services provided by vendors like AWS, Microsoft Azure, and Google Cloud, offering scalability and cost efficiency but operating in a shared environment. In contrast, a private cloud is a dedicated infrastructure used by a single organization, providing greater control, security, and customization.
Both cloud models serve as the building blocks of hybrid cloud and multi-cloud strategies, but they serve different business needs.
What is Hybrid Cloud?
A hybrid cloud model integrates private infrastructure with public cloud services, allowing businesses to move workloads between them based on security, performance, and scalability requirements.
Key Benefits of Hybrid Cloud:
- Enhanced Security & Compliance: Organizations with strict regulatory requirements, such as healthcare and finance, can store sensitive data in a private cloud while using the public cloud for scalable computing.
- Integration with Legacy Systems: Many companies still rely on on-premises infrastructure that cannot fully transition to the cloud. Hybrid cloud ensures compatibility without complete migration.
- Cost Optimization: Businesses can minimize public cloud expenses by keeping stable, predictable workloads in a private cloud while leveraging public cloud resources for variable, high-demand workloads.
- Controlled Scalability: Companies can expand computing resources on demand without overinvesting in private infrastructure.
How Hybrid Cloud Works:
Organizations securely connect their private and public cloud environments using VPNs, Direct Connect (AWS), ExpressRoute (Azure), or Interconnect (Google Cloud). Sensitive data remains on private infrastructure, while less critical workloads run in the public cloud. Hybrid cloud management platforms like AWS Outposts, Google Anthos, and Azure Arc help streamline operations across environments.
What is Multi-Cloud?
A multi-cloud strategy uses multiple public cloud providers to spread workloads across different platforms. Instead of integrating private and public cloud environments like hybrid cloud, multi-cloud relies solely on multiple cloud vendors to increase flexibility and reduce reliance on any single provider.
Key Benefits of Multi-Cloud:
- Avoiding Vendor Lock-In: Businesses can prevent dependency on a single cloud provider by distributing workloads across multiple platforms.
- Performance Optimization: Different cloud providers excel in different areas—for example, Google Cloud is ideal for AI workloads, while AWS provides strong enterprise solutions. Multi-cloud allows businesses to choose the best provider for each task.
- Increased Redundancy & Disaster Recovery: If one cloud provider experiences downtime, workloads automatically failover to another provider, ensuring uninterrupted operations.
- Cost Flexibility: Organizations can optimize costs by choosing the most affordable services across multiple providers, taking advantage of pricing differences.
How Multi-Cloud Works:
Organizations deploy workloads across different cloud providers based on performance, cost, and compliance needs. They manage security, identity access, and workload distribution through multi-cloud orchestration tools like Terraform, Kubernetes, and Anthos. However, security becomes more complex due to varying IAM policies, different security configurations, and inconsistent compliance requirements across cloud platforms.
Key Differences Between Hybrid Cloud and Multi-Cloud
While hybrid cloud focuses on integrating private and public cloud environments, multi-cloud spreads workloads across multiple cloud providers. Each strategy addresses different business needs.
Infrastructure & Architecture
Hybrid cloud blends private and public clouds, ensuring seamless data flow and workload distribution between them. Multi-cloud, however, does not require private cloud infrastructure—it simply leverages multiple public cloud providers.
Primary Use Cases
Hybrid cloud is ideal for organizations needing strict security and compliance while benefiting from cloud scalability. Industries such as finance, healthcare, and government often prefer hybrid cloud because it keeps regulated data within controlled environments.
Multi-cloud, on the other hand, is well-suited for businesses that want to avoid vendor lock-in, optimize performance, and increase redundancy. Global enterprises and companies with diverse cloud-based workloads often choose multi-cloud to balance their IT infrastructure.
Security & Compliance Challenges
Hybrid cloud offers greater control over security policies and compliance since private cloud resources remain within the company’s infrastructure. It allows for tighter access controls and customized security configurations.
Multi-cloud presents greater security complexity as businesses must manage different security frameworks, IAM policies, and compliance requirements across cloud providers. Implementing a zero-trust security model and centralized IAM is crucial for ensuring consistent security.
Cost Considerations
Hybrid cloud comes with predictable costs, but organizations must invest in private cloud infrastructure and maintenance. Public cloud usage is supplementary rather than the primary cost driver.
Multi-cloud can optimize costs by distributing workloads based on pricing models, but businesses must track hidden expenses like data transfer fees and cross-cloud networking costs to avoid unnecessary expenses.
Scalability & Flexibility
Hybrid cloud scalability is limited by private cloud resources, requiring additional infrastructure investments for expansion. Multi-cloud is more scalable, allowing businesses to provision resources instantly from any cloud provider without infrastructure constraints.
Disaster Recovery & Redundancy
Hybrid cloud relies on backup solutions and secondary data centers for disaster recovery, limiting redundancy. Multi-cloud provides greater resilience as workloads can shift to another cloud provider if one fails.
Which Cloud Strategy is Right for Your Business?
Choosing between hybrid cloud and multi-cloud depends on business priorities, technical expertise, and security needs.
Hybrid Cloud is Ideal If:
- Security and Compliance Are Top Priorities – Industries that require strict data residency and regulatory compliance benefit from hybrid cloud’s controlled environments.
- Legacy Infrastructure Still Exists – Businesses with on-premises systems can gradually transition to the cloud without full migration.
- Workloads Require Predictability – Hybrid cloud ensures stable performance for mission-critical applications while leveraging cloud scalability when needed.
Multi-Cloud is the Best Fit If:
- Avoiding Vendor Lock-In is Essential – Companies that want flexibility and competitive pricing across providers should opt for multi-cloud.
- Disaster Recovery is a High Priority – Organizations needing failover capabilities benefit from multi-cloud’s ability to shift workloads across providers.
- Performance Optimization is a Key Concern – Businesses that require different cloud services for AI, big data, and enterprise applications can optimize performance with multi-cloud.
